Nearly half of enterprise AI use bypasses corporate security: Akamai report

Ai Lei Tao
Last updated: August 12, 2026 at 9:21 AM
Ai Lei Tao
Published: August 12, 2026
5 Min Read

Companies are facing new AI-related cybersecurity risks as employees are using many AI tools, as well as rogue browser extensions and vulnerable autonomous agents that have exposed organisations to new types of cyberattacks, according to an Akamai report.

While AI use has grown across business functions, it revealed, much of the risk is concentrated among a small group of highly active “AI power users” who account for a large share of enterprise AI exposure.

Nearly half or 47.11 per cent of all enterprise AI conversations occur via personal identities, instead of corporate-managed accounts (52.89 per cent).

This “shadow AI” is activity that has not been approved, monitored or audited by IT, security, or compliance teams, according to Akamai, which provides content delivery and security services to businesses.

Its report also found that corporate AI adoption has shifted sharply since early 2025, moving from cautious experimentation to becoming a structural part of business operations. However, Akamai warned that this integration has outpaced traditional security controls.

“AI is no longer just a productivity booster; it is a collaborative colleague with direct access to the corporate crown jewels,” said Or Eshed, the vice-president for enterprise security product and engineering at Akamai.

He added that traditional data loss prevention (DLP) tools were built for an earlier era of file transfers and e-mails, while sensitive corporate information is now being broken up across prompts, personal accounts and autonomous AI agents.

“Security leaders must pivot from trying to block AI to continuously governing how it operates at the interaction level,” he advised. 

New AI-native threats

The report highlighted three emerging AI-native attack methods discovered by researchers in 2026, which Akamai said can bypass traditional perimeter defences.

The first, described as vibe hacking, involves attackers covertly changing local markdown instruction files in a developer’s environment. These modifications can trick AI coding assistants into generating insecure code or carrying out unauthorised actions while appearing to follow the developer’s normal workflow.

The second, called CursorJacking, involves rogue browser extensions using broad permissions to silently collect API keys, proprietary codebases and conversation history from the browser environment. Akamai said this technique targets users of popular AI coding assistants, including Cursor.

The third, CometJacking, uses indirect prompt injection. Attackers embed malicious instructions on a public webpage, which can then manipulate a user’s local AI agent.

According to Akamai, a compromised agent may be able to exfiltrate local files, e-mails and session credentials without the user’s knowledge. The report said this threat targets agentic browsers such as Perplexity’s Comet AI.

Strategies to secure AI

For organisations to gain the benefits of AI without exposing critical data, the report suggests five mitigation strategies for chief information security officers (CISOs).

Businesses should first focus on high-risk AI power users, directing monitoring, telemetry and tailored coaching toward the small group of employees driving the majority of interactive AI prompts, according to Akamai.

It also called on companies to reduce shadow AI by enforcing single sign-on (SSO) federation across platforms and continuously discovering the long tail of niche AI software-as-a-service tools being used within the organisation.

Security teams, it said, should move beyond static DLP and inspect the AI interaction layer in real time, including prompts, copy-and-paste buffers and document uploads.

Organisations are also urged to treat browser and integrated development environment extensions as highly privileged software. According to Akamai, almost 75 per cent of AI extensions request high or critical permissions, while 16.3 per cent contain known vulnerabilities.

Finally, the company said businesses need to secure autonomous AI agents by setting strict least-privilege boundaries and introducing behavioural monitoring for agents that act on behalf of employees.
